Dental implants use a small titanium post that acts as an artificial tooth root, supporting a custom-made crown that looks natural and blends with your smile. This treatment restores both function and appearance, allowing you to eat, speak and smile with confidence.

What Is The Dental Implant Process in Our Carrollwood Office?
The dental implant process is carefully planned and performed to maximize your comfort. Our team will guide you every step of the way, from your initial consultation to your final restoration.
The process includes:
- Consultation: We assess your oral health, review your goals, and take 3D images to plan your treatment.
- Implant Placement: The titanium post is placed into your jawbone under local anesthesia or sedation.
- Healing: Over several months, the implant fuses with your bone in a process called osseointegration.
- Restoration: A custom crown, bridge, or denture is attached to the implant for a natural look and feel.
Are Dental Implants Right for You?
Dental implants are ideal for adults with healthy gums and enough jawbone to support the implant. They may not be suitable for everyone, especially those with certain medical conditions or untreated gum disease.
